CVE-2026-72477
Linux ntfs3 rename bug can leave inodes inconsistent, risking data corruption and DoS.
Is CVE-2026-72477 being exploited?
Not confirmed. CVE-2026-72477 does not appear in CISA's Known Exploited Vulnerabilities catalog, which records only exploitation that has been observed and reported publicly. That is evidence of absence of a report, not evidence the flaw is unattacked. EPSS currently estimates a 0.52% probability of exploitation in the next 30 days.
How severe is CVE-2026-72477?
CVE-2026-72477 is rated Critical with a CVSS score of 9.8. Severity describes how bad exploitation would be, not how likely it is: pair it with exploitation evidence before deciding what to patch first.
Is there a patch for CVE-2026-72477?
Yes. A fix has been recorded for CVE-2026-72477. The vendor advisory is the authority on the exact fixed version — apply it from there rather than from a summary.
What does CVE-2026-72477 affect?
CVE-2026-72477 affects Linux kernel ntfs3 filesystem driver, Distributions using kernels with ntfs3 (mainline and backports). Confirm the exact affected versions against the vendor advisory before deciding you are exposed.
What should I do about CVE-2026-72477?
Apply updated Linux kernel with ntfs3 fix; check/remount and run fsck on NTFS volumes.

Local user or attacker with write/mount access can trigger inode inconsistency on NTFS, causing kernel WARN, data corruption or denial of service.
